Purpose:
The mission and purpose of the Texas A&M Health Science Center School of Nursing Student Nurses' Association is to organize, represent, and mentor students preparing for initial licensure as registered nurses, as well as those enrolled in baccalaureate completion programs. Convey the standards and ethics of the nursing profession. Promote development of the skills that students will need as responsible and accountable members of the nursing profession. Advocate for high quality health care. Advocate for and contribute to advances in nursing education. Develop nursing students who are prepared to lead the profession in the future.
